William E. Skaggs, Sr., 92 of Indianapolis passed away peacefully July 28, 2018 at his home surrounded by his family. He was born June 3, 1926 in Indianapolis.
He served his country in the US Navy from 1944-1946. He spent his career as a contractor working alongside his family members. He was involved in the Center Township GOP Club, Christian Park Neighborhood Association, a Precinct Committeeman and a volunteer for the American Red Cross for 20 years. He loved gardening and the outdoors.
He is survived by his children Judy Lizenby, William E. Skaggs, Jr, Nancy Wills, Michael Skaggs, June Borden, Nannette McCotter, Gwendolyn Skaggs, and Jacqueline Skaggs; 13 grandchildren and many great-gr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his wife of 61 years Henrietta Louise Skaggs; his parents William E. Skaggs and Leah Croan, and step-father Willis J. Croan.
